Hot Melt Optimization employs a proprietary data collection method using proprietary sensors on the assembly line, which, when combined with Microsoft’s predictiveanalytics and Azure cloud for manufacturing, enables P&G to produce perfect diapers by reducing loss due to damage during the manufacturing process.

Recently, EUROGATE has developed a digital twin for its container terminal Hamburg (CTH), generating millions of data points every second from Internet of Things (IoT)devices attached to its container handling equipment (CHE).
